Speed Up a Slow Mac Laptop

⏱ 2 min read 🛠 Step-by-step 🆓 Free to read 📅 Updated May 7, 2026 · Pyflo Editorial

Most Macs slow down from RAM pressure and background processes eating CPU, not age. Fix path: free diagnostics → software cleanup → hardware upgrade.

Free Diagnostics First

  1. Open Activity Monitor (Spotlight search or Applications > Utilities)
  2. Click 'Memory' tab — if 'Memory Pressure' graph is yellow/red, you need more RAM or to close apps
  3. Click 'CPU' tab — sort by '% CPU' to find hogs. Common culprits: Chrome with 50+ tabs, Spotlight indexing after updates, Photos library sync, Google Drive/Dropbox

Immediate Free Fixes

  1. Restart — clears RAM leaks from apps running for days
  2. Reduce Login Items: System Settings > General > Login Items — remove apps you don't need at startup (Spotify, Slack, Adobe Creative Cloud all auto-launch and eat RAM)
  3. Disable visual effects: System Settings > Accessibility > Display > Reduce motion (helps older Macs)
  4. Clear browser cache/extensions: Chrome extensions alone can use 2GB+ RAM. Safari > Settings > Extensions — disable what you don't use daily
  5. Free up disk space: Macs with less than 15% free storage slow dramatically. Delete old iOS backups (Finder > your Mac name > Manage Backups), clear Downloads folder, empty Trash

Software Cleanup Tools

  1. Check for macOS updates: System Settings > General > Software Update — performance fixes often included

  3. Reset SMC and NVRAM (Intel Macs only — Apple Silicon doesn't need this)

Hardware Upgrades (Intel Macs Only)

Apple Silicon Macs (M1/M2/M3/M4) have soldered RAM and storage — cannot be upgraded. If you have an Intel Mac (2020 or earlier):

  1. Add RAM: 8GB is bare minimum for modern macOS, 16GB is comfortable. Cost: $50-150 depending on model
  2. Upgrade to SSD: If you have a spinning hard drive (HDD), upgrading to SSD is transformative. Cost: $100-300 + installation. Best Buy offers Mac upgrade services

When to Consider Replacement

If your Mac is pre-2017 with 4GB RAM and you cannot upgrade it, a new MacBook Air (starting around $999-1099) will feel 10x faster than trying to optimize the old one. Apple Silicon chips (M1 and newer) outperform 2019 Intel i7 MacBooks while using less power.

Pro tip: Enable 'Optimize Storage' in System Settings > General > Storage. macOS auto-removes watched TV shows and old email attachments to keep 15%+ free space, which prevents slowdowns. Also check for 'Other' storage bloat — often cached app data.
